House Bill
1119
By: Representative Floyd of the 138th
A BILL TO BE
ENTITLED
AN ACT
To amend an Act providing for the Board of Education of
Pulaski County and consolidating and restating the laws relative thereto,
approved April 4, 1991 (Ga. L. 1991, p. 4175), as amended, so as to change the
description of the education districts; to provide for definitions and
inclusions; to provide for continuation in office of current members; to provide
for election and terms of office of members; to provide for submission of this
Act for approval under the federal Voting Rights Act of 1965, as amended; to
provide for effective dates;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other
purposes.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F
GEORGIA:
SECTION 1.
An Act providing for the Board of Education of Pulaski
County and consolidating and restating the laws relative thereto, approved April
4, 1991 (Ga. L. 1991, p. 4175), as amended, is amended by striking Section 1 of
said Act and inserting in its place the following:
"SECTION
1.
(a) The Board of Education of Pulaski County shall be
composed of seven members who shall be elected as provided in this Act. Those
members of the Board of Education of Pulaski County who are serving as such on
December 31, 2002, and any person selected to fill a vacancy in any such office
shall continue to serve as such members until the regular expiration of their
respective terms of office and upon the election and qualification of their
respective successors. On and after January 1, 2003, the Board of Education of
Pulaski County shall consist of seven members all of whom shall be elected from
education districts described in subsection (b) of this section. Education
Districts 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, and 7, as they exist on December 31, 2002, shall
continue to be designated as Education Districts 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, and 7,
respectively, but as newly described under this Act, and on and after January 1,
2003, such members of the board serving from those former education districts
shall be deemed to be serving from and representing their respective districts
as newly described under this Act.
(b) For purposes of
electing members of the board of education, the Pulaski County School District
is divided into seven education districts. One member of the board shall be
elected from each such district. The seven education districts shall be and
correspond to those seven numbered districts described in and attached to and
made a part of this Act and further identified as Plan Name: pulaskiwk3 Plan
Type: Local User: Gina Administrator: Pulaski Co.
(c)
When used in such attachment, the terms 'Tract' and 'BG' (Block Group) shall
mean and describe the same geographical boundaries as provided in the report of
the Bureau of the Census for the United States decennial census of 2000 for the
State of Georgia. The separate numeric designations in a Tract description
which are underneath a 'BG' heading shall mean and describe individual Blocks
within a Block Group as provided in the report of the Bureau of the Census for
the United States decennial census of 2000 for the State of Georgia. Any part
of the Pulaski County School District which is not included in any such district
described in that attachment shall be included within that district contiguous
to such part which contains the least population according to the United States
decennial census of 2000 for the State of Georgia. Any part of the Pulaski
County School District which is described in that attachment as being in a
particular district shall nevertheless not be included within such district if
such part is not contiguous to such district. Such noncontiguous part shall
instead be included within that district contiguous to such part which contains
the least population according to the United States decennial census of 2000 for
the State of Georgia. Except as otherwise provided in the description of any
education district, whenever the description of such district refers to a named
city, it shall mean the geographical boundaries of that city as shown on the
census map for the United States decennial census of 2000 for the State of
Georgia.
(d) Each member of the board of education
shall be a resident of the respective education district during the member's
term of office. Each person offering for election as a member of said board
shall specify the education district for which the person is offering. Each
member of the board shall be elected by a majority vote of the qualified voters
voting within each respective district. All members of the board shall be
elected in nonpartisan elections without prior nonpartisan primaries as provided
for in this Act, and otherwise in accordance with the provisions of the general
election laws of this
state."
SECTION 2.
It shall be the duty of the attorney of the Board of
Education of Pulaski County to submit this Act for approval pursuant to Section
5 of the federal Voting Rights Act of 1965, as amended.
SECTION 3.
This section and Section 2 of this Act and those provisions
of this Act necessary for the election of members of the Board of Education of
Pulaski County in 2002 shall become effective upon the approval of this Act by
the Governor or upon its becoming law without such approval. The remaining
provisions of this Act shall become effective January 1,
2003.
SECTION 4.
All laws and parts of laws in conflict with this Act are
repealed.
